Структурирование обработчиков в Telegram-ботах для оптимизации взаимодействия
Рассмотрение целей, для которых можно использовать Telegram-бот, объяснение процесса его разработки на языке Python с использованием библиотеки pyTelegramBotAPI. Взаимодействие с людьми для пересылки текстов, изображений, видеоклипов и звуковых файлов.
Подобные документы
Принципы формирования растрового и векторного изображения. Способность растровых форматов нести дополнительную информацию. Проблема сохранения изображений для последующей их обработки. Наиболее распространенные алгоритмы сжатия. Преобразование файлов.
курсовая работа, добавлен 19.04.2011Компьютерное моделирование человеческой способности к порождению высказываний как цель порождения текстов на естественном языке. Условия разнопланового развития и творческого потенциала в порождении текстов. Формализация представления грамматики языка.
статья, добавлен 22.01.2016Изучение файловых операций ввода/вывода с использованием библиотеки управления потоками C++. Характеристика и функции основных операторов, которые позволяют читать и записывать данные в файл. Создание программы с использованием операторов ввода/вывода.
реферат, добавлен 01.12.2009Конструирование устройства для дистанционного доступа к информации о получении корреспонденции на бумажном носителе. Использование микроконтроллера Iskra JS для решения поставленной задачи. Схематичное изображение дальномера и хода ультразвуковых волн.
реферат, добавлен 16.05.2019Алгоритм разработки скрипта, задачей которого является поиск в заданном каталоге всех файлов определенной размерности. Особенности использования командной строки в среде Linux для осуществления статистического сбора информации по хранящимся файлам.
контрольная работа, добавлен 19.04.2021Обработка изображений: технология, методы и применение. Представление знаний с помощью правил продукции как самой распространенной формы реализации базы знаний. Применение программы для прямой цепочки рассуждений на языке программирования Python.
статья, добавлен 17.02.2019Современные способы, системы и библиотеки, направленные на преобразование графической информации в текстовую интерпретацию. Области применения данных технологий. Приложение, написанное на языке C#, направленное на считывание текста из графических файлов.
статья, добавлен 21.02.2022Реализация алгоритма кодирования Хаффмана - метода оптимального префиксного кодирования, используемого для сжатия данных. Принцип работы алгоритма, его применение и преимущества. Реализация алгоритма на языке Go с использованием стандартной библиотеки.
статья, добавлен 19.12.2024Анализ операционных характеристик сети Джексона. Максимальная пропускная способность, среднее время ожидания обслуживания, среднее число отказов в обслуживании. Имитационная модель на языке python. Компьютерное моделирование системы с тремя узлами.
курсовая работа, добавлен 14.09.2018Характеристика нового метода фильтрации изображений с использованием эллипсов Петунина. Сравнение исследуемого метода с методом фильтрации изображений на основе маргинального ранжирования для выявления основных преимуществ и недостатков нового метода.
статья, добавлен 14.09.2016Разработка приложения со стандартным графическим интерфейсом пользователя в среде программирования Microsoft Visual Studio на языке программирования С# с использованием библиотеки классов NET. Описание программного обеспечение и руководство пользователя.
курсовая работа, добавлен 14.11.2017Графические файлы как файлы, в которых хранятся любые типы устойчивых графических данных, предназначенных для последующей визуализации. Проблемы сохранения изображений для последующей обработки и их важность. Недостатки векторного и растрового форматов.
реферат, добавлен 07.06.2015Ввод-вывод данных с использованием библиотеки потокового ввода вывода. Директивы препроцессора. Включение файлов в компилируемый файл, определение символических констант и макросов, компиляция кода программы и условное выполнение директив препроцессора.
лабораторная работа, добавлен 23.11.2018Методы сжатия информации: RLE (Run Length Encoding), LZW (Lempel–Ziv–Welch), метод сжатия Хаффмана и др. Формирование растровых изображений в процессе сканирования многоцветных иллюстраций и фотографий. Расширения графических файлов векторного формата.
реферат, добавлен 07.12.2016Параметризация свёрточной нейронной сети для осуществления семантического анализа текста и определения его эмоциональной окраски. Архитектура сети, её обучение и тестирование с использованием объектно-ориентированного языка Python и библиотеки Keras.
статья, добавлен 19.02.2019Компьютерная обработка звука с помощью профессионального редактора звуковых файлов Sound Forge. Способы компрессии звуковой информации. Запись звукового фрагмента и его обработка с помощью наиболее часто используемых эффектов. Воспроизведение MP3-файлов.
лабораторная работа, добавлен 25.05.2013Описание процесса проектирования и разработки игрового приложения "Лабиринт", которое представляет собой игру, написанную на языке Java с использованием стандартных библиотек Java и интегрированной среды разработки Eclipse. Графический интерфейс.
курсовая работа, добавлен 19.11.2018Ознакомление с процессом разработки игры в 3D-графике с определенным игровым процессом и возможностью взаимодействия по сети. Описание библиотеки DirectX. Рассмотрение основных правил и руководства пользователя разрабатываемого компьютерного приложения.
дипломная работа, добавлен 05.06.2014Обоснование выбора аппаратно-инструментальных средств умного дома. Алгоритм создания программного приложения для реализации бота в мессенджере Telegram. Порядок программирования центрального контроллера бытового ассистента с дистанционным контролем.
дипломная работа, добавлен 02.09.2018Рассмотрение основных подходов к решению задачи поиска файлов, разработка и оценка модели приложения с учетом текущих требований к программному обеспечению. Выбор средств разработки и архитектура приложения. Программа и методика испытаний приложения.
курсовая работа, добавлен 18.05.2023Оптимизация JPEG/GIF – файлов для наилучшего соотношения между размером файла и качеством изображения. Настройка опции Dithering. Создание прозрачной основы и карты изображения в гипертексте. Пакетная автоматизированная обработка оптимизируемых файлов.
лекция, добавлен 16.11.2017Изучение биографии выдающихся личностей XX ст., создателей социальных сетей интернета - Марка Эллиота Цукерберга, Ияра Голдфингера и Павла Валерьевича Дурова. Оценка их доходов и состояния. Описание социальных сетей: Facebook, Вконтакте и Telegram.
биография, добавлен 04.12.2017Создание П. Дуровым практичного портала для общения "Вконтакте". использование им особенной технологии шифрования переписки для создания проекта "Telegram" - по-настоящему безопасного канала общения. Другие популярные приложения, созданные Дуровым.
презентация, добавлен 05.06.2018Совместное использование метода локальной оптимизации и алгоритма последовательного анализа вариантов для улучшения качества процесса разработки программного обеспечения. Методы усовершенствования процессов жизненного цикла автоматизированных систем.
статья, добавлен 04.02.2017Рассмотрены программные решения, которые можно использовать для формирования клиентских договоров агентствами недвижимости. Приведены их особенности, дано обоснование необходимости разработки новой подсистемы и описаны предъявляемые ей требования.
статья, добавлен 21.12.2024